Situation:
A ridge over the country tracks east today while a deepening low and associated fronts approach central and northern Aotearoa New Zealand from the Tasman Sea. Tomorrow the low moves onto central and northern New Zealand while another low moves east past the Far South. On Thursday, a deep and extensive low moves slowly east over the North Island. The low is expected to lie slow moving just northeast of the North Island on Friday. Meanwhile, a ridge of high pressure gradually builds over the lower half of the South Island. On Saturday, the ridge expands further northward as the low continues to drift east away from the country.
